### Resize jobs hang at "uploading"

If `pixelherd batch-resize` stalls after processing completes, the upload worker usually failed to reach the Driftbasin asset store. Check that the CLI is on v3.2+, which retries with backoff, and confirm outbound TLS isn't intercepted by the review proxy. Note for security review: the CLI reads credentials from the environment, never from disk. It authenticates uploads with this bearer token:

portal login ticket: eyJhbGciOiJIUzI1NiIsInR5cCI6IkpXVCJ9.eyJzdWIiOiIwEOsktwVNwIn0.-UJU3fdyyCgG

## Deploying the Gatewick Proctor Queue

Deploys are pretty painless: push to main, wait for the pipeline, then watch the queue drain dashboard for five minutes. If candidates pile up mid-exam, roll back first and ask questions later — the queue replays safely. Everything the workers care about lives in one config block, shown here for reference.

settings of bafof-yagef:
JOROX_PIN=8740
JOROX_TENANT=pelox
JOROX_METRICS_HOST=metrics.jorox.qorvelworks.internal
JOROX_SEAL=seal_c78f63c1
JOROX_STANDBY_TEAM=norax

## v2.8.0 — Gatehouse API Gateway

Renamed `THROTTLE_KEY` to `RATELIMIT_SIGNING_SECRET` to clarify that this value signs rate-limit tokens rather than selecting a throttle tier. Deployments still referencing the old name will fail closed at startup, which is intentional. Operators must update the gateway's env file during the upgrade window; the legacy key is ignored entirely. To complete migration, the env file must contain the new setting on its own line, like so:

sealed setting: LEDGER_TOKEN5=bcca1

**Onboarding Note — Spare Hardware Store (Contractors)**

The spare hardware store is Room 2.14 at Calder Point, beside the second-floor lift lobby. Please take only items listed on your approved job sheet, record each item in the ledger inside the door, and relock on exit. The keypad on the door accepts the entry code below.

turnstile pass: bdg-FVNQRS-72965873